tinyurl.com、is.gd和bit.ly的python url shortner库
python-shorturl的Python项目详细描述
一个使用三个URL缩短服务之一缩短URL的Python库支持以下服务:
-tinyurl.com
-bit.ly,j.mp,bitly.com(必须使用login和apikey)
-is.gd
installation
===
wget https://github.com/appscluster/python shorturl/archive/master.zip
<7z x master.zip(如果您没有7z:sudo apt get install p7zip full)
cd python shorturl master/
用法
=
>命令行:
用法:shorturlpy.py[-u][-d][-l][-a]
-u--url full url http://www.google.co.uk
-d--默认值any,tinyurl,is.gd,bitly
-l——bitly login
-a——apikey bitly apikey
示例:
>默认值:
python-m shorturlpy.shorturlpy-u http://www.appscluster.com
tinyurl:
python-m shorturlpy.shorturlpy-u http://www.appscluster.com-d tinyurl
is.gd:
python-mshorturlpy.shorturlpy-u http://www.appscluster.co m-d是.gd
bitly:
python-m shorturlpy.shorturlpy-u http://www.domain.co-d bitly-l xyz\u login-a zyx\u key
注意:用自己的bitly帐户详细信息替换xyz登录名和zyx\u key
loadurl=shorturlpy.shorturlpy()
print loadurl.shortenurl('http://www.appscluster.com')
print loadurl.shortenurl('http://www.appscluster.com','tinyurl')
print loadurl.shortenurl('http://www.appscluster.com','is.gd')
print loadurl.shortenurl('http://www.appscluster.com','bitly',,“xyz庘u login”、“zyx庘u key”)
注意:用您自己的比特帐户详细信息替换xyz庘u login和zyx庘u key
在由abdul hamid开发的python 2.7上测试
-tinyurl.com
-bit.ly,j.mp,bitly.com(必须使用login和apikey)
-is.gd
installation
===
wget https://github.com/appscluster/python shorturl/archive/master.zip
<7z x master.zip(如果您没有7z:sudo apt get install p7zip full)
cd python shorturl master/
用法
=
>命令行:
用法:shorturlpy.py[-u][-d][-l][-a]
-u--url full url http://www.google.co.uk
-d--默认值any,tinyurl,is.gd,bitly
-l——bitly login
-a——apikey bitly apikey
示例:
>默认值:
python-m shorturlpy.shorturlpy-u http://www.appscluster.com
tinyurl:
python-m shorturlpy.shorturlpy-u http://www.appscluster.com-d tinyurl
is.gd:
python-mshorturlpy.shorturlpy-u http://www.appscluster.co m-d是.gd
bitly:
python-m shorturlpy.shorturlpy-u http://www.domain.co-d bitly-l xyz\u login-a zyx\u key
注意:用自己的bitly帐户详细信息替换xyz登录名和zyx\u key
loadurl=shorturlpy.shorturlpy()
print loadurl.shortenurl('http://www.appscluster.com')
print loadurl.shortenurl('http://www.appscluster.com','tinyurl')
print loadurl.shortenurl('http://www.appscluster.com','is.gd')
print loadurl.shortenurl('http://www.appscluster.com','bitly',,“xyz庘u login”、“zyx庘u key”)
注意:用您自己的比特帐户详细信息替换xyz庘u login和zyx庘u key
在由abdul hamid开发的python 2.7上测试